温馨提示×

centos中mysql如何升级版本

小樊
39
2025-09-30 11:32:50
栏目: 云计算

在CentOS系统中升级MySQL版本,可以按照以下步骤进行:

方法一:使用yum包管理器

  1. 备份数据库 在进行任何升级操作之前,请务必备份所有重要的数据库数据。

    mysqldump -u root -p --all-databases > full_backup.sql 
  2. 移除旧版本的MySQL

    sudo yum remove mysql mysql-server 
  3. 安装新版本的MySQL 例如,如果你想升级到MySQL 8.0,可以使用以下命令:

    sudo yum install mysql80-community-release-el7-3.noarch.rpm sudo yum update mysql-community-server 
  4. 启动并启用MySQL服务

    sudo systemctl start mysqld sudo systemctl enable mysqld 
  5. 安全配置MySQL 运行安全配置脚本以设置root密码和其他安全选项:

    sudo mysql_secure_installation 
  6. 检查版本 登录到MySQL并验证新版本是否已安装成功:

    mysql -u root -p 

    在MySQL提示符下输入:

    SELECT VERSION(); 

方法二:使用MySQL官方提供的升级工具

  1. 下载并安装MySQL升级工具 访问MySQL官方网站下载适用于CentOS的升级工具(如mysql_upgrade)。

  2. 运行升级工具 根据官方文档的说明,运行mysql_upgrade命令来检查和升级数据库系统表:

    sudo mysql_upgrade -u root -p --force 
  3. 重启MySQL服务 升级完成后,重启MySQL服务以应用更改:

    sudo systemctl restart mysqld 

注意事项

  • 兼容性检查:在升级之前,确保新版本的MySQL与你的应用程序和现有数据库架构兼容。
  • 测试环境:在生产环境中进行升级之前,最好先在测试环境中进行模拟升级。
  • 依赖关系:检查并更新所有相关的依赖包,以避免潜在的冲突。

参考资料

通过以上步骤,你应该能够顺利地在CentOS系统中升级MySQL版本。如果在过程中遇到任何问题,请参考相关文档或寻求社区支持。

0